Kathmandu Pokhara Chitwan Tour Distance


Approximate distances between destinations:



  • Kathmandu to Pokhara: about 200 kilometers

  • Pokhara to Chitwan: about 150 kilometers

  • Chitwan to Kathmandu: about 160 kilometers


Travel time depends on transportation methods such as tourist buses, private vehicles, or domestic flights.


Kathmandu Pokhara Chitwan Tour Itinerary (7 Days)


Day 1: Arrival in Kathmandu


Arrive at Tribhuvan International Airport. Transfer to your hotel and explore the lively streets and markets of Thamel.


Day 2: Kathmandu Sightseeing Tour

Day 3: Kathmandu to Pokhara


Travel to Pokhara by tourist bus or domestic flight.


In Pokhara, visit:



  • Phewa Lake

  • Lakeside tourist area

  • Tal Barahi Temple


Pokhara offers beautiful views of the Annapurna mountain range.


Day 4: Pokhara Sightseeing


Popular attractions include:



  • Sarangkot sunrise viewpoint

  • Davis Falls

  • Gupteshwor Cave

  • World Peace Pagoda

  • International Mountain Museum


The city is famous for its relaxed atmosphere and natural beauty.


Day 5: Pokhara to Chitwan


Travel from Pokhara to Chitwan National Park.


Activities include:



  • Village walk

  • Tharu cultural dance show

  • Sunset view near Rapti River


Day 6: Chitwan Jungle Safari


Experience exciting wildlife activities:



  • Jeep safari inside Chitwan National Park

  • Canoe ride on Rapti River

  • Bird watching

  • Visit elephant breeding center


Chitwan is home to one-horned rhinoceroses, Bengal tigers, crocodiles, and many bird species.


Day 7: Chitwan to Kathmandu


Return to Kathmandu by road or flight. Enjoy optional shopping or prepare for departure.


Kathmandu Pokhara Chitwan Tour Package Price


Tour package prices vary depending on hotel category and services.


Budget Tour Package


500 to 700 USD per person


Includes basic hotels, transportation, and sightseeing.


Standard Tour Package


800 to 1,200 USD per person


Includes comfortable hotels, guided tours, and safari activities.


Luxury Tour Package


1,500 USD or more per person


Includes luxury hotels, private transportation, and premium services.


Best Time for Kathmandu Pokhara Chitwan Tour


Nepal can be visited throughout the year, but the best seasons include:



  • Spring (March to May) – Pleasant weather and blooming landscapes

  • Autumn (September to November) – Clear skies and excellent mountain views

  • Winter (December to February) – Cooler temperatures but comfortable travel

Transportation Options


Travelers can move between destinations using different transportation options.



  • Tourist buses – Affordable and widely used

  • Private cars – Comfortable and flexible

  • Domestic flights – Fastest option between Kathmandu and Pokhara

Frequently Asked Questions


What is the Kathmandu Pokhara Chitwan tour?

It is a travel package covering Nepal’s cultural, scenic, and wildlife destinations.


How many days are required for the tour?

Most itineraries range from 6 to 8 days.


How far is Pokhara from Kathmandu?

The distance is about 200 kilometers.


How far is Chitwan from Pokhara?

The distance is about 150 kilometers.


What is the cost of Kathmandu Pokhara Chitwan tour?

Prices usually range between 500 and 1,500 USD depending on the package.


What is the best time to visit these destinations?

Spring and autumn seasons offer the best weather.


What wildlife can be seen in Chitwan?

Rhinos, crocodiles, deer, and occasionally Bengal tigers.


Is Pokhara good for adventure sports?

Yes, activities include paragliding, ziplining, and boating.


How long does the jungle safari take?

Most jungle safaris last around 3 to 4 hours.
